ENGINES FOR AFRICA OFFERS MOTORS YOU CAN TRUST FUND

Engines For Africa Offers Motors You Can Trust Fund

Engines For Africa Offers Motors You Can Trust Fund

Blog Article

A Full Guide to Choosing the Right Engine for Your Task



Choosing the appropriate engine for your job is a vital decision that can considerably impact its overall success. Each of these components plays a critical duty in ensuring that your selected engine not just fulfills instant purposes yet likewise straightens with long-lasting desires.


Define Your Task Demands





Defining your job needs is a critical action in picking the suitable engine for effective execution. An extensive understanding of your project's objectives will certainly direct you in recognizing the capacities and attributes required from an engine. Begin by detailing the scope of your project, including the desired performance, target audience, and the certain results you aim to attain.


Following, consider the technological requirements that line up with your project objectives. This includes examining the compatibility of the engine with existing systems, in addition to the programs languages and structures that will certainly be made use of. In addition, assess the level of scalability required to accommodate future development or adjustments in need.


Budget plan restraints also play an important role in specifying your project needs. Establish a clear monetary structure to guide your decision-making procedure, ensuring that the engine picked fits within your budget plan while offering the essential performance.


Evaluate Efficiency Needs



Engines For AfricaEngines For Africa
Once you have a clear understanding of your project needs, the following action is to assess the performance demands of the engine. Efficiency encompasses various variables including speed, source, performance, and scalability intake. Begin by establishing the anticipated tons and use patterns of your application. If your project involves real-time handling or high-frequency transactions, prioritize engines that supply low latency and high throughput.


Engines that support horizontal scaling are usually more effective for larger applications. In addition, evaluate the engine's efficiency under various problems, such as peak use scenarios, to ensure it satisfies your integrity standards.


Think About Ease of Use



While technological specifications are crucial, the convenience of use of an engine can dramatically impact the development procedure and overall job success. An instinctive user interface, clear documents, and streamlined process can substantially decrease the understanding contour for developers, enabling them to concentrate on imagination and analytical instead of grappling with complex tools.


When assessing an engine's simplicity of usage, think about the onboarding experience. A well-structured introduction, total with tutorials and example tasks, can facilitate a smoother shift for new customers. In addition, the clearness and comprehensiveness of the engine's documentation play a critical duty; extensive overviews and API references can empower designers to fix and execute attributes efficiently.


An engine that enables for very easy adjustments can be more user-friendly, as programmers can tailor it to fit their specific requirements without extensive trouble. Ultimately, choosing an engine that focuses on ease of use can lead to an extra effective and delightful growth experience.


Assess Community and Assistance



The stamina of an engine's area and support network can considerably influence a developer's experience and success. When assessing an engine, consider the size and see it here activity degree of its neighborhood.


Additionally, examine the schedule of official assistance channels. Reliable documentation, receptive customer assistance, and normal updates are vital for addressing technological problems and keeping your task on the right track. Engines For Africa. Energetic neighborhoods likewise promote cooperation, providing possibilities for networking and comments, which can be indispensable, particularly for independent developers or small teams




In addition, explore the existence of community-run occasions, such as hackathons or meetups. These gatherings can enhance your understanding of the engine while attaching you with potential partners and seasoned users. In summary, a robust neighborhood and support system not only simplify growth but likewise create an atmosphere for finding out and technology, eventually boosting the probability of your task's success.


Contrast Price and Licensing Options



Budget plan considerations play a crucial duty in picking the ideal engine for your job, as the cost and licensing options can substantially influence both temporary costs and long-term feasibility. Engines For Africa. Different engines provide varying pricing structures, which can consist of one-time purchase fees, registration models, or revenue-sharing arrangements based on your task's incomes


Engines For AfricaEngines For Africa
When contrasting expenses, it's important to evaluate not just the initial investment however also recurring costs related to updates, assistance, and added functions. Some engines may appear low-cost in the beginning glimpse but enforce high costs later due to concealed costs or required add-ons. On the other hand, much more expensive engines could supply detailed devices and support that might ultimately save time and sources.


Accrediting choices additionally vary dramatically. Some engines are open-source, using adaptability and community-driven support, while others may need proprietary licenses that limit usage and distribution. Comprehending the ramifications of each licensing model is crucial, as it influences ownership rights, future scalability, and potential lawful obligations.


Verdict



To conclude, selecting the proper engine for a task necessitates an extensive evaluation about his of specified task needs, performance needs, ease of usage, area support, and cost factors to consider. By methodically attending to these important aspects, decision-makers can ensure placement with both current and future project needs. An educated option eventually improves the possibility of job success, allowing effective resource have a peek at this site appropriation and taking full advantage of possible outcomes within the specified budgetary restrictions.


Selecting the suitable engine for your job is an essential choice that can considerably affect its general success.Specifying your project needs is a critical step in choosing the appropriate engine for successful execution. A detailed understanding of your project's objectives will certainly lead you in determining the capacities and functions needed from an engine.When you have a clear understanding of your project requires, the next step is to examine the efficiency requirements of the engine.In conclusion, choosing the proper engine for a project demands a detailed evaluation of specified project requirements, efficiency needs, ease of usage, area assistance, and price considerations.

Report this page